Aimee McNally
The outdoor seating was heated and protected overhead from elements. The table style was awkward for sitting next to my husband, but they were open to moving people around if you don’t like the table. The wait staff was attentive and pleasant. I was disappointed that the indoor seating was not open. I really love the vibe inside and hope that indoor seating will return soon. We mostly had the vegetarian options – peanut noodle bowl (delicious flavor, tangy lime, scrumptious), grilled veggie plate (the mushrooms were so good!), and Dragon Fries (delicious, spicy, and fish flakes are Bonita tuna). The drinks are always excellent, strong, and unique. My husband enjoyed the Cinder and Smoke (he enjoys spicy and smoke), and I had the Quarter After Five (it was a beautiful mix of orange and bourbon). Great place for a date night. I don’t recommend taking kids here, the menu is designed for a mature palate.
